Protein Coding Gene : Pgm1 phosphoglucomutase 1

Primary Identifier  MGI:97565 Organism  mouse, laboratory
Chromosome  4 NCBI Gene Number  72157
Mgi Type  protein coding gene
description  FUNCTION: Automated description from the Alliance of Genome Resources (Release 7.0.0)

Enables phosphoglucomutase activity. Acts upstream of or within glucose metabolic process. Predicted to be located in Z disc. Predicted to be active in cytosol. Is expressed in embryo and heart.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in congenital disorder of glycosylation It; endometrial cancer; and teratoma. Orthologous to human PGM1 (phosphoglucomutase 1).
PHENOTYPE: Homozygous knockout is embryonic lethal, while heterozygous KO leads to reduced viability. [provided by MGI curators]
